John Barnes confirms I'm A Celebrity appearance?

Liverpool legend John Barnes appears to confirm that he will appear on this year's I'm A Celebrity, Get Me Out Of Here.

Former Liverpool winger John Barnes has hinted that he has signed up to appear on this year's edition of I'm A Celebrity, Get Me Out Of Here.

The 56-year-old pundit previously appeared on Strictly Come Dancing in 2007 and finished seventh, memorably earning a 10 from the judges after impressing with his salsa.

Despite the ongoing threat of coronavirus, ITV are still pressing ahead with plans to air I'm A Celebrity from Australia in November and now Barnes has suggested that he will be part of the lineup.

"I've done a number of shows in my days, from Family Fortunes to Strictly Come Dancing but nothing as adventurous as I'm a Celeb," he told BonusCodeBets. "And to be honest, there's nothing that I wouldn't eat or anything I wouldn't do. I'm fairly easy-going. If they asked me to do something, I'd do it.

"And from the point of view of eating anything, I eat everything and anything, so I'd probably be ideal for the show. The only fear I have is of sharks so by saying this I'm sure they're going to put me in a tank with sharks but I guess that's the nature of the game. But everything else I would be fine with.

"Similar to why I went on to do Strictly Come Dancing all those years ago, it'd be good to lose some weight, perhaps try to beat Nick Knowles's two-stone weight loss."

Other names in the frame for this year's show include Beverley Callard, Eric Cantona, Charles Ingram and AJ Pritchard.
